We've heard of dogs saving the lives of familes when fire errupts inside a home, but what about a pig?

An Illinois family is crediting their pet potbellied pig named Lucky for saving their lives when their trailer home caught fire over the weekend.

According to WFIE, Ina Farler said Lucky woke up the grandmother and her grandchildren by squealing, jumping to and from the bed and running to the door.  She said when she finally sat up, Farler realized the room was filling with smoke.

When firefighters arrived at the home, flames were shooting from the side of the trailer according to the Courier Press.

The house and everything the family owned is gone, but Farler and her family, including Lucky got out of the fire safely WFIE reported.
